It is *NOT* possible to insert and pop/delete at the same time. 28// Callers must protect the *rb pointer separately. 29 30// Create a ringbuffer with the specified size 31// Returns NULL if memory allocation failed. Resulting pointer must be freed 32// using |ringbuffer_free|. 33ringbuffer_t* ringbuffer_init(const size_t size); 34 35// Frees the ringbuffer structure and buffer 36// Save to call with NULL. 37void ringbuffer_free(ringbuffer_t* rb); 38 39// Returns remaining buffer size 40size_t ringbuffer_available(const ringbuffer_t* rb); 41 42// Returns size of data in buffer 43size_t ringbuffer_size(const ringbuffer_t* rb); 44 45// Attempts to insert up to |length| bytes of data at |p| into the buffer 46// Return actual number of bytes added. Can be less than |length| if buffer 47// is full. 48size_t ringbuffer_insert(ringbuffer_t* rb, const uint8_t* p, size_t length); 49 50// Peek |length| number of bytes from the ringbuffer, starting at |offset|, 51// into the buffer |p|. Return the actual number of bytes peeked. Can be less 52// than |length| if there is less than |length| data available. |offset| must 53// be non-negative. 54size_t ringbuffer_peek(const ringbuffer_t* rb, off_t offset, uint8_t* p, 55 size_t length); 56 57// Does the same as |ringbuffer_peek|, but also advances the ring buffer head 58size_t ringbuffer_pop(ringbuffer_t* rb, uint8_t* p, size_t length); 59 60// Deletes |length| bytes from the ringbuffer starting from the head 61// Return actual number of bytes deleted. 62size_t ringbuffer_delete(ringbuffer_t* rb, size_t length); 63
